				| import pyray as rl
 | |
| from enum import IntEnum
 | |
| 
 | |
| MOUSE_WHEEL_SCROLL_SPEED = 30
 | |
| INERTIA_FRICTION = 0.95  # The rate at which the inertia slows down
 | |
| MIN_VELOCITY = 0.1  # Minimum velocity before stopping the inertia
 | |
| 
 | |
| 
 | |
| class ScrollState(IntEnum):
 | |
|   IDLE = 0
 | |
|   DRAGGING_CONTENT = 1
 | |
|   DRAGGING_SCROLLBAR = 2
 | |
| 
 | |
| 
 | |
| class GuiScrollPanel:
 | |
|   def __init__(self, show_vertical_scroll_bar: bool = False):
 | |
|     self._scroll_state: ScrollState = ScrollState.IDLE
 | |
|     self._last_mouse_y: float = 0.0
 | |
|     self._offset = rl.Vector2(0, 0)
 | |
|     self._view = rl.Rectangle(0, 0, 0, 0)
 | |
|     self._show_vertical_scroll_bar: bool = show_vertical_scroll_bar
 | |
|     self._velocity_y = 0.0  # Velocity for inertia
 | |
| 
 | |
|   def handle_scroll(self, bounds: rl.Rectangle, content: rl.Rectangle) -> rl.Vector2:
 | |
|     mouse_pos = rl.get_mouse_position()
 | |
| 
 | |
|     # Handle dragging logic
 | |
|     if rl.check_collision_point_rec(mouse_pos, bounds) and rl.is_mouse_button_pressed(rl.MouseButton.MOUSE_BUTTON_LEFT):
 | |
|       if self._scroll_state == ScrollState.IDLE:
 | |
|         self._scroll_state = ScrollState.DRAGGING_CONTENT
 | |
|         if self._show_vertical_scroll_bar:
 | |
|           scrollbar_width = rl.gui_get_style(rl.GuiControl.LISTVIEW, rl.GuiListViewProperty.SCROLLBAR_WIDTH)
 | |
|           scrollbar_x = bounds.x + bounds.width - scrollbar_width
 | |
|           if mouse_pos.x >= scrollbar_x:
 | |
|             self._scroll_state = ScrollState.DRAGGING_SCROLLBAR
 | |
| 
 | |
|         self._last_mouse_y = mouse_pos.y
 | |
|         self._velocity_y = 0.0  # Reset velocity when drag starts
 | |
| 
 | |
|     if self._scroll_state != ScrollState.IDLE:
 | |
|       if rl.is_mouse_button_down(rl.MouseButton.MOUSE_BUTTON_LEFT):
 | |
|         delta_y = mouse_pos.y - self._last_mouse_y
 | |
| 
 | |
|         if self._scroll_state == ScrollState.DRAGGING_CONTENT:
 | |
|           self._offset.y += delta_y
 | |
|         else:
 | |
|           delta_y = -delta_y
 | |
| 
 | |
|         self._last_mouse_y = mouse_pos.y
 | |
|         self._velocity_y = delta_y  # Update velocity during drag
 | |
|       else:
 | |
|         self._scroll_state = ScrollState.IDLE
 | |
| 
 | |
|     # Handle mouse wheel scrolling
 | |
|     wheel_move = rl.get_mouse_wheel_move()
 | |
|     if self._show_vertical_scroll_bar:
 | |
|       self._offset.y += wheel_move * (MOUSE_WHEEL_SCROLL_SPEED - 20)
 | |
|       rl.gui_scroll_panel(bounds, rl.ffi.NULL, content, self._offset, self._view)
 | |
|     else:
 | |
|       self._offset.y += wheel_move * MOUSE_WHEEL_SCROLL_SPEED
 | |
| 
 | |
|     # Apply inertia (continue scrolling after mouse release)
 | |
|     if self._scroll_state == ScrollState.IDLE:
 | |
|       self._offset.y += self._velocity_y
 | |
|       self._velocity_y *= INERTIA_FRICTION  # Slow down velocity over time
 | |
| 
 | |
|       # Stop scrolling when velocity is low
 | |
|       if abs(self._velocity_y) < MIN_VELOCITY:
 | |
|         self._velocity_y = 0.0
 | |
| 
 | |
|     # Ensure scrolling doesn't go beyond bounds
 | |
|     max_scroll_y = max(content.height - bounds.height, 0)
 | |
|     self._offset.y = max(min(self._offset.y, 0), -max_scroll_y)
 | |
| 
 | |
|     return self._offset
